Medical Refrigerators Market - Cumulative Impact of United States Tariffs 2025 - Global Forecast to 2030

The Medical Refrigerators Market size was estimated at USD 4.32 billion in 2024 and expected to reach USD 4.59 billion in 2025, at a CAGR 6.26% to reach USD 6.23 billion by 2030.

Introduction to the Critical Dynamics of the Medical Refrigerator Sector

Medical refrigerators are indispensable assets in modern healthcare infrastructure, ensuring the integrity of lifesaving vaccines, biologics, pharmaceuticals and laboratory reagents. Rapid advancements in disease prevention, personalized medicine and biotechnology have amplified the need for highly reliable refrigeration solutions that maintain precise temperature ranges under stringent conditions. Concurrently, heightened regulatory scrutiny, particularly in cold chain validation and qualification protocols, has elevated performance benchmarks, compelling manufacturers to innovate around energy efficiency, sustainability and real-time monitoring capabilities.

Moreover, the integration of Internet of Things (IoT) platforms and advanced data analytics has redefined equipment management, fostering predictive maintenance protocols that minimize downtime and optimize total cost of ownership. Stakeholders are increasingly prioritizing solutions that offer remote monitoring, automated alert systems and robust data logging to ensure compliance with global standards and instill confidence in supply chain continuity. As the industry transitions towards greener operations, eco-friendly refrigerants and intelligent energy management systems are emerging as critical differentiators, enabling organizations to reduce carbon footprints while enhancing operational resilience. Transformative Technological and Operational Shifts Shaping the Market

In recent years, the medical refrigeration sector has undergone a series of transformative shifts that are reshaping design philosophy, procurement strategies and service models. One of the most notable trends is the ubiquitous adoption of smart refrigeration systems embedded with IoT sensors, which deliver continuous temperature readings, cloud-based analytics and automated compliance reporting. These solutions empower facility managers to respond proactively to deviations, leveraging predictive maintenance algorithms to preempt equipment failures and extend lifecycle performance.

Simultaneously, energy efficiency has evolved from a cost consideration to a strategic imperative. Advanced insulation materials, variable-speed compressors and dynamic defrost cycles are now standard features in premium models, driving down total cost of ownership and aligning with broader sustainability mandates. The shift towards eco-conscious refrigerants has accelerated in response to tightening environmental regulations, prompting manufacturers to develop low global warming potential alternatives that maintain thermal stability.

Customization is another pivotal shift, as end-users demand modular configurations tailored to specific applications, whether that entails ultra-low-temperature storage for biological samples or compact, portable units for remote clinics. This trend has catalyzed partnerships between equipment providers and service specialists, fostering integrated solutions that combine installation, validation and lifecycle management under unified service agreements. As these operational and technological innovations converge, the industry is poised for a new phase of growth characterized by intelligent, sustainable and resilient refrigeration ecosystems.

Assessing the 2025 United States Tariffs and Their Sector-Wide Implications

Implementation of the 2025 US tariffs on imported refrigeration equipment and key components has introduced a fresh layer of complexity to supply chain management and cost structures. By applying additional duties on certain finished units and raw materials originating from targeted regions, importers have experienced a pronounced increase in landed costs, necessitating recalibration of pricing models and contract terms. This tariff landscape has also exacerbated lead-time variability, as suppliers adjust procurement volumes to mitigate exposure, thereby testing the agility of distribution networks.

In response, manufacturers are accelerating efforts to localize production, form strategic alliances with domestic fabricators and diversify sourcing strategies to circumvent tariff-related disruptions. A growing number of stakeholders are exploring nearshoring initiatives within the Americas, seeking manufacturing partnerships in Mexico and Latin America to maintain access to critical components without incurring punitive duties. Additionally, renegotiation of framework agreements with existing suppliers has become commonplace, aiming to shift the burden of increased tariffs through cost-sharing mechanisms and volume-based rebates.

While short-term headwinds are evident in the form of price volatility and margin compression, this environment is also driving innovation in vertical integration and collaborative ecosystem models, which may yield long-term benefits by enhancing supply chain transparency, reducing dependency on offshore suppliers and fortifying resilience against future trade policy fluctuations. Moreover, end-users are beginning to factor tariff-induced cost variances into their procurement timelines, prioritizing long-term service agreements that absorb potential future tariff escalations and ensure uninterrupted operational capacity.

Deep Dive into Market Segmentation Insights and Demand Drivers

Analyzing the market through multiple segmentation lenses reveals nuanced demand patterns that inform strategic positioning. Segmentation by product type shows that vaccine refrigerators are experiencing accelerated adoption due to global immunization campaigns, while blood bank refrigerators maintain a steady requirement in clinical settings. Chromatography refrigerators and laboratory refrigerators are witnessing increased customization requests, reflecting sophisticated research workflows, and pharmacy refrigerators are being tailored for retail pharmacies prioritizing customer-facing vaccine administration. Segmentation based on storage capacity indicates that units below 200 liters are favored in smaller clinics and mobile testing units, mid-range capacities between 200 and 500 liters dominate standard hospital pharmacies, and high-capacity models exceeding 500 liters are critical for biopharmaceutical manufacturers and large research institutes. When evaluating portability, portable design refrigerators are gaining traction for field applications and mobile vaccination drives, whereas stationary designs remain the backbone of centralized laboratory infrastructures. A focus on door type segmentation reveals an emerging preference for double door configurations in high-volume environments to optimize compartmentalization and reduce thermal loss, while single door units continue to serve compact or specialized-use cases. From an end-user perspective, diagnostic centers and p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ies are driving capital investments in advanced refrigeration, supported by regulatory compliance imperatives. Finally, distribution channel segmentation highlights the continued dominance of traditional offline sales complemented by a growing share of online channels, especially for standardized, lower-capacity models.

Regional Dynamics and Growth Opportunities Across Key Territories

Regional analysis uncovers distinct growth trajectories shaped by healthcare infrastructure maturity, regulatory frameworks and distribution capabilities. In the Americas, robust public and private investment in cold chain expansion-driven by vaccination drives and advanced research initiatives-has catalyzed demand for cutting-edge refrigeration systems with data logging and remote monitoring features. High healthcare expenditure per capita and established maintenance networks further underpin steady market expansion. The Europe, Middle East & Africa region presents a dichotomy: Western Europe’s stringent environmental and safety standards are pushing equipment upgrades toward eco-friendly refrigerants and enhanced energy efficiency, while Middle Eastern markets are embracing large-scale cold storage facilities to support growing medical tourism, and select African nations are focusing on portable and off-grid solutions to address rural healthcare challenges. In the Asia-Pacific region, rapid industrialization, expanded pharmaceutical manufacturing and large-scale immunization programs in countries such as India and China are driving volume purchases, complemented by increasing interest in premium, feature-rich models. Government initiatives to bolster domestic manufacturing and local content regulations are also encouraging regional production, which in turn accelerates technology transfer and cost optimization. These distinct regional dynamics offer diverse entry points for equipment providers targeting tailored product portfolios and strategic partnerships.

Competitive Landscape and Strategic Positioning of Leading Manufacturers

The competitive landscape is characterized by a mix of multinational conglomerates, specialized instrument manufacturers and regionally focused players competing on innovation, quality and service excellence. Aegis Scientific, Inc. and Blue Star Limited have strengthened their market presence through comprehensive service networks and localized manufacturing capabilities, while Dulas Ltd. and Fiocchetti Scientific S.R.L. are distinguished by their expertise in laboratory-specific refrigeration solutions. Felix Storch, Inc. and PHC Holdings Corporation leverage extensive distribution channels to support diverse end-user segments, and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. continues to capitalize on its global footprint and integrated laboratory portfolio. In the premium category, Liebherr-international AG and Vestfrost Solutions command attention with high-performance compressors and sustainable refrigerant technologies, whereas Haier Biomedical and Qingdao Aucma Global Medical Co., Ltd. emphasize scalable production capacities to meet the demands of emerging markets. Niche players such as Helmer, Inc. by Trane Technologies Company, LLC and Migali Scientific are carving out specialized applications in cold storage for clinical research, and Indrel and Standex International Corporation are innovating around ultra-low-temperature and cryogenic storage solutions. Additional market participants including Follett Products, LLC, Godrej & Boyce Manufacturing Company Limited, HMG India, Labcold Ltd, LEC Medical, Philipp Kirsch GmbH, So-Low Environmental Equipment Co., Inc., TempArmour Refrigeration, Terumo Corporation and ZHONGKE MEILING CRYOGENICS COMPANY LIMITED contribute to dynamic competitive pressures that drive continuous product development, service enhancements and strategic collaborations across the value chain.
